þeostrian

Old English

Alternative forms

Etymology

From Proto-Germanic *þeustrōną, *þiustrijaną.

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/ˈθe͜oːs.tri.ɑn/

Verb

þēostrian

  1. to darken, to grow dark
  2. to dim the sight
